The Luminous Reunion: The Moonlit Heir
In the heart of the ancient kingdom of Luminara, where the sky was painted with the vibrant hues of twilight, there lived a young woman named Elara. Her eyes, a deep shade of sapphire, held the secrets of her past, a past that had been shrouded in mystery since the day she was born.
Elara had always been different from the other children of her village. She was drawn to the moon, its silver glow casting an ethereal light on her path. The elders whispered of the Mid-Autumn Festival, a time when the full moon was at its zenith, and the veil between worlds was thinnest. It was said that on this night, the chosen one would be revealed.
As the festival approached, Elara felt a strange pull, as if the moon itself was calling her. She was to be the Moonlit Heir, a figure foretold in ancient prophecies, destined to wield the power of the full moon and bring peace to the land.
One evening, as the moon began to rise, Elara climbed the highest peak in the kingdom, a place her parents had forbidden her to visit. The air was crisp, and the stars twinkled like diamonds in the night sky. She felt a strange warmth in her chest, a sensation she couldn't quite place.
Suddenly, a soft glow emanated from the ground below. Elara descended cautiously, her heart pounding with a mix of fear and curiosity. She found a small, ornate box, its surface etched with symbols she had never seen before. As she opened it, a single, shimmering amulet fell into her hand. It was the Amulet of the Full Moon, a relic of immense power.
As the moon reached its peak, Elara felt a surge of energy course through her veins. The amulet glowed with an inner light, and she was surrounded by a luminous aura. The villagers below saw the spectacle and rushed to witness the event.
The village elder, an ancient man with eyes that seemed to see into the past, approached Elara. "You are the Moonlit Heir," he declared. "This amulet has been waiting for you, and now it is time for you to fulfill your destiny."
Elara's journey had only just begun. The elder revealed that the amulet was not only a source of great power but also a key to unlocking the secrets of her lineage. She was the last descendant of a royal bloodline that had long vanished, a bloodline that was intertwined with the moon's own magic.
As Elara journeyed through the kingdom, she encountered numerous challenges. She had to confront the dark forces that sought to exploit the amulet's power for their own gain. Her quest led her to hidden temples, enchanted forests, and ancient ruins, each filled with mysteries waiting to be unraveled.
One night, as she camped beneath the full moon, Elara had a vision. She saw her ancestors, their faces etched with determination and courage. They spoke of a great prophecy, one that spoke of a time when the kingdom would be threatened by a formidable enemy. The Moonlit Heir was to rise and unite the people, harnessing the power of the full moon to defeat the darkness.
Elara realized that her journey was not just about herself but about the entire kingdom. She had to learn to control the amulet's power, a task that was easier said than done. The amulet's magic was volatile, and Elara struggled to balance its immense energy with her own will.
In a climactic battle, Elara faced her greatest challenge yet. The enemy, a sorcerer who had long sought to dominate Luminara, unleashed his dark magic upon her. The battle was fierce, and the fate of the kingdom hung in the balance.
As the moon began to wane, Elara found herself at the edge of a cliff, the sorcerer's shadow looming over her. In a moment of desperation, she channeled the amulet's power, her body glowing with a celestial light. With a shout of determination, she hurled the amulet towards the sorcerer, and it shattered against his form, banishing his dark magic.
The kingdom was saved, but Elara's journey was far from over. She had to unite the people, bridge the divide between them, and ensure that the land remained at peace. With the support of her newfound allies, she embarked on a quest to spread the light of the full moon, a symbol of hope and unity.
Elara's story became a legend, one that would be told for generations to come. The Mid-Autumn Festival was celebrated with even greater fervor, as the people honored the Moonlit Heir and the magical power of the full moon.
In the end, Elara learned that the true power of the amulet was not in its magic but in the unity it fostered. It was the collective will of the people that truly brought about change. And so, with the full moon as her guiding light, Elara became the beacon of hope for the kingdom of Luminara, a story that would live on in the hearts and minds of all who heard it.
